## Ownership

The Ledgerlook audit-log viewer is maintained as a core internal tool at Bramforth Labs. Ownership covers the ingestion parser, the redaction layer, and the query UI. Any schema change must be raised at the weekly eng sync before implementation. Accountability for the whole component sits with one engineer, whose full name follows below.

account owner for fajep-yagef: Kasix Eliiel

RUNBOOK 7.4 — Permit Blueprint Transfers (Ostermark Site)

Scope: original blueprints supporting the Ostermark annex building permit. Tube-cased, sealed, flagged DO NOT FOLD. Shift lead verifies case seal and manifest line 12 before release. Blueprints never sit overnight on the dock; if the run slips, return them to the plan vault. One courier only, no relay transfers. Photograph the seal at release. The courier's confidential hand-over instruction appears directly below this fragment.

drop instructions, yafog-yawip: the quenmir olidor courier leaves the julox tamion keliel ledger at gate 5283 under passcode 336825

Ticket #— Floor 9 Opening Prep, Brindlemoor House

Hi facilities folks, Floor 9 opens to staff next Monday and we need a few things squared away before then. Lift access is live, but the two side doors by the kitchenette are still on the old lock config — please reprogram them before Friday. Also, signage for the quiet rooms hasn't arrived, so pop up the temporary printed ones for now. Until the badge readers sync, the interim door code for Floor 9 is below.

door code, bajop-bajog: bdg-DSWAC-43621

Finance Review Summary — Dorvath Components plc
For: The Board

Inventory write-down of obsolete Keldric valve stock recognised this quarter; impact 2.1% of gross margin. Root cause: over-ordering ahead of the cancelled Norbay contract. Controls tightened; reorder thresholds revised. No further write-downs anticipated. Forward plans are set out in the note below.

confidential, kagep-kahof: Druokax Systems plans to lower the Ulaath list price by 53 percent in March.